Quebrada Pumarangra
Quebrada Pumarangra is a stream in Arequipa, Peru and has an elevation of 4,638 metres. Quebrada Pumarangra is situated nearby to the hamlet Yanahuasi, as well as near Huañajahua.Places of Interest

Aljajahua
Peak
Aljajahua is a mountain in the Huanzo mountain range in the Andes of Peru, about 4,800 metres high. It is situated in the Arequipa Region, Condesuyos Province, Cayarani District.
Puma Ranra
Peak
Puma Ranra erroneously also spelled Pumrangra) is a mountain in the Wansu mountain range in the Andes of Peru, about 4,800 metres high. It is situated in the Arequipa Region, Condesuyos Province, Cayarani District. Puma Ranra is situated 3 km north of Quebrada Pumarangra.
